Soil Table

Our burst of inspiration that takes this whole “green” idea quite literally continues today with an interesting project spotted at Core77 called the Soil Table.

 

The Israeli designer, Ori Mishkal, explains some of the thinking behind this 2010 student project:

l wanted to design an object which suggested a way to bring nature into the living space in an intimate way… to see the ‘underground growth’ of the plants by placing them upside-down to grow.

The sensation of feeling plants on your lap, while sitting at the table, would add a unique tactile element to the already distinctive visuals presented by this quirky reuse of an old table.
